You are standing in the middle of a large room listening to a cacaphony of sounds. Rank the intensity level of the sounds from each source (1=loudest, 2= next loudest, ...) Consider all objects to be right next to you. (Remember that if you have a tie, you skip some ranks.)
1. Two buzzers each producing a sound with intensity level of 48dB.
2. Ten buzzers each producing a sound with intensity level of 42dB.
3. One hundred buzzers each producing a sound with intensity level of 28dB.
4. An object emitting a sound with an intensity of 50dB.
Explanation / Answer
loudest
2. Ten buzzers each producing a sound with intensity level of 42dB. = 52db
1. Two buzzers each producing a sound with intensity level of 48dB. = 51 dB
4. An object emitting a sound with an intensity of 50dB. = 50db
3. One hundred buzzers each producing a sound with intensity level of 28dB. = 48db
